The Team
Deloitte Tax LLP's Tax Transformation Office (TTO) is responsible for the design, development, and deployment of innovative, enterprise technology, tools, and standard processes to support the delivery of tax services. The TTO team focuses on enhancing Deloitte Tax LLP’s ability to deliver comprehensive, value-added, and efficient tax services to our clients. It is a dynamic team with professionals of varying backgrounds from tax technical, technology development, change management, Six Sigma, and project management. The team consults and executes on a wide range of initiatives involving process and tool development and implementation including training development, engagement management, tool design, and implementation.
